The missing european number format (#.###,##) instead of #,###.##) was a real pain for me as well.
I have customers entering number values in different ways via form, so i cannot use number input fields. However since i do have to make calculations and output values on those fields for reporting, I struggled a lot.
I use a text field and thanks to the “number and currency pretty routines” i was able to build something that would allow me to transform a text field into a numeric field to do calculations and then to make it pretty for reporting.
However this only works for values below 1.000.000.
Maybe this will be of use to some of you out there and maybe someone wants to build on that to make it work for numbers over 1.000.000.
Here is the base:
All the best